Opened in 1927, the St. James Theatre has hosted a diverse array of acclaimed performances that challenge conventions and spark important conversations. Its opulent interior, featuring intricate architectural details and plush seating, reflects the grandeur of 1920s Broadway. In 2015, the theatre received a significant sound technology upgrade, enhancing acoustics and ensuring every word and note resonates clearly, elevating the overall audience experience. Notable past productions include the 2010 staging of the musical Promises, Promises, with music by Burt Bacharach, which exemplifies the theatre’s tradition of hosting iconic shows.
